In the present age, if the government gets rid of cash currency and adopts digital means of payment, there will be a lot of challenges because of the elderly people around us. This world is not only occupied by young people whose minds are digitally wired, but we also have our old mothers and fathers who are not eligible or capable of operating this digital asset. Instead, there should be a balance of cash and digital payment for peace to reign in our country.

It will be so unlawful to get rid of cash currency. Most of the time, I do find it difficult to make a transfer when I buy from the market, because of network issues and a low battery. This evening I went to buy a bag of sachet water, just to make a transfer of #500. I stood there for some minutes, and mosquitoes were perched on me. It's discouraging most times. A few weeks ago, I made a transaction twice with someone, from whom I bought a t-shirt. Why did that happen? It was because of a bad network. Imagine the woman wasn't a church member, what would I have done? I called the woman, and she said that's true, she refunded the money. Was if I was dealing with a criminal.

Cashless policy shouldn't occur again; it brings frustration, and our elderly individuals would not be able to relate if the government gets rid of it. And there will be a lot of scandalous issues. How about those who do not have a bank account in the village, how will they make a living? There are days that power supply will not come for people to power up their phones. I mean everything will just be full of ups and downs.

And if digital currency is to be operated, then cyber crimes will increase too. An alternative to hacking people's accounts will com,e, and it will not be nice at all.

I remembered the last cashless policy we had; it wasn't funny at all. We saw old, sick, and a whole lot of people who weren't supposed to be outside because of their health conditions. I ended up seeing them in the queue because of money.

Therefore, there should be a balance, and it is the best option. The government should continue to encourage digital payment and cash payment because of our elderly, and they shouldn't eliminate them completely. Both should be operated fairly.
